Key Lime Pie

This past week, was a birthday baking extravaganza. Dustin helped me with the chocolate cake (see previous post) and Ryan assisted with the Key Lime Pie (both for Chelsea's birthday party). The help was much appreciated, and they both turned out wonderfully. I bought a new blue tart pan from Target. The bottom comes out for easy removal. It worked great! Here's how it turned out.



Of course, this is before I removed it from the pan. I just loved the color of the dish with the color of the dessert. Here is the recipe that I used. It's Ina Garten, again. I told you...I just love her recipes. My only tip on this recipe is to butter the pie pan. If you don't, your bottom crust will stick. It was a nightmare to get out. Lesson learned!


Chocolate Cake

I decided that I wanted to try a chocolate cake completely from scratch, so I found a recipe by Ina Garten (she's my favorite) on food network and set off in the kitchen. I made the batter and chocolate butter cream and each had a hint of coffee or espresso. It was yummy! This is a perfect chocolate cake recipe.



This photo was taken the second time I made the cake which was for my brother's girlfriend's birthday. Hence the chocolate chip "C" on top. Her name is Chelsea, and she love chocolate and coffee!

Anywho, here is the recipe that I used. It is the best tasting chocolate cake! Totally worth the time, effort, and calories! Oh, and be careful what kind of coffee you put in the batter. The better the flavor of your coffee the better the flavor of your cake!
